Exegesis

The relative asher {אֲשֶׁר | ʼăšer} chains two clauses: what you have heard (shamata {שָׁמַעְתָּ | šāməʻtā}) and what they have blasphemed (gidfu {גִּדְּפוּ | giddəpû}).

In context2 Kings 19:6

And Isaiah said to them, “Thus you shall say to your master: ‘Thus says the LORD , Do not fear the words that you have heard which the young men of the king of Assyria have blasphemed Me .’”
